Join The Seattle Foundation tomorrow, May 2, for the second annual GiveBIG– a one-day, online charitable giving event to benefit nonprofits in our community. Donations made to nonprofits through The Seattle Foundation’s website will be stretched further thanks to The Seattle Foundation and GiveBIG sponsors, who will match a share of every contribution.
“Each donation made through The Seattle Foundation’s website between midnight and midnight (Pacific Time) on May 2, 2012 will receive a pro-rated portion of the matching funds (or “stretch”) pool. The amount of the “stretch” depends on the size of the stretch pool and how much is raised in total donations on GiveBIG day. For example, if a nonprofit organization receives 3 percent of the total donations during GiveBIG, then it will receive 3 percent of the stretch pool, so the more donations you give through GiveBIG on May 2 the more it will benefit SIFF,” reads SIFF’s email on the campaign.
